Worn pads may show up as squealing, reduced stopping response, or a thinning friction layer. For even, balanced braking, it's best practice to replace the pads on both sides of the axle together as a matched set.

Which axle does this pad set fit?
This is a rear-axle disc brake pad set. It covers the rear position for the listed BMW applications.
Does this set include hardware?
Yes. Per the manufacturer, this application-specific set ships with hardware and features bonded shims to help reduce braking noise.
What friction material are these pads?
They're made with the same pad material type — ceramic, semi-metallic, or NAO — that originally came on the vehicle, so it varies by application.
Do these pads need a break-in period?
The pads are post-cured, which the manufacturer states eliminates the need for a break-in. Always follow the vehicle service procedure during installation.
